hello everyone,

Do any of you find that replies from a hotmail account which include the 
original mail, show corruption as shown below in the included text:

&gt;I've read the free extracts from Mike Pilinksi's book and I'm sure 
they provide excellent advice for mainstreams. He gives lists of things 
to do and not do that will multiply many times your chance of appearing 
to be a &amp;quot;good catch&amp;quot; but that chance is zero.

I think logically this is only is reply to html mails.
Apart from disallowing html in the lists altogether, can anyone explain 
why this is happening and suggest a fix?
btw I think I've seen the same trouble in non-list mails too; ie a 
hotmail reply direct to me where the original included html.
